2009 in Zambia refers to the events that occurred the year 2009 in the Republic of Zambia.

Crime[edit]

  • Regina Chiluba, wife of former President Frederick Chiluba, was arrested on charges of fraud. On 3 March, she was sentenced to three and half years for illegally receiving government funds and properties.[1]
